- Title
THE MEASUREMENT AND DEVELOPMENT OF COMPETENCE IN THE USE OF CAREER ASSESSMENTS.
- Authors
Etheridge, Roy L.; Peterson, Gary W.
- Abstract
A prototype measure of competency in the use of assessments in career counseling, A Measure of Assessment Competency [AMAC], was developed in response to a professional need to operationalize the meaning of competency in career assessment. A 6 by 3 matrix, with six competencies and three levels of development, was employed as the conceptual framework for the AMAC. The Career Thoughts Inventory (CTI) was used as the assessment instrument of observation for the study. Total competency scores of the AMAC were significantly associated with the number of CTIs administered under the supervision of a faculty trainer.
